(01-15-2013 12:19 AM)samuraitrev Wrote: Just keep your eye on them and make sure they keep their points. Don't let any paint get into the metal ferrule. If you do clean it straight away. Only clean them in cold water, never hot as it can ruin the glue holding the bristles. Store them point upwards in an old cup. Happy painting. Good things to know.
